Webster City woman wins $1 million lottery jackpot

She realized she had won the prize shortly after receiving a message from a friend.

WEBSTER CITY, Iowa — Lynne Kannuan told the Iowa Lottery she usually waits several weeks before seeing if her lottery ticket is a winning one, but that all changed one month ago.

Kannuan's friend in Arkansas messaged her, telling her someone in Webster City won the $1 million prize in the Powerball drawing the previous night. Upon checking her ticket, which she had in her purse, she found that she won a drawing from Monday, Aug. 5.

She claimed her prize on Wednesday in Clive. Kannuan said she checked the numbers twice just to be sure, before going straight to her boss's office and telling them she had just won $1 million.

Kannuan and her husband immigrated to the United States as children, and after winning the prize reflected on how far they've both come in their lives. The family plans to continue their days as normal, with Kannuan describing the winning amount as "not too much, not too little, just right."

Kannuan bought her ticket at the Fareway on 942 Second St in Webster city while stopping for groceries on her way home from work. That Fareway received $1,000 for selling the winning ticket. 

The winning numbers on the Aug. 5 drawing were 29-42-44-51-54 and Powerball 12.
